Should I Consult A Doctor For Discomfort And Dryness In Vaginal Area?
I have discomfort/dryness In my vaginal area. I notice when I am walking it really bothers me. I feel like I need something to pull me up tight. I do used replenish cream and other creams. When I insert the application I feel the dryness. Do I need to go to a certain doctor to be check? Thank YYYY@YYYY
Hello, Dryness is a common feature in the peri-menopausal and the post menopausal state as the hormones dwindle. This can be managed with vaginal creams, suppositories and patches which contain estrogen and help to improve the secretions and thereby lubrication. You may also try hormone replacement therapy with benefits if you fit into the category. Please see a gynecologist for a local examination and further management of your condition.
